Quote (Raysokuk @ 15 Feb. 2006 (19:33)) | I've just been made aware of this topic! You can't sell a model of the prow as it is an IP issue (there are loop holes around this but you start doing things that are ilegal for other reasons, harder to trace but with a far harsher penalty!)
Anyway, There are no plans from SG to release a Voss prow! (that I know of)
FW are thinking about it, but are so busy doing what they want to that it hasn't been put in motion.
The problem with the model was the thin bit just before the engines. The problem occurs because it's a metal model and they use a centifuge (sp!) to make metal models. Becasue of the shape this lead to the engine section often making the model unacceptable to sell (due to too little metal getting to the edge of the mould where the engine is). It was something like 10-20% that were naff, meaning they'd need actual people to sort through it all and pick out the crap ones (they just don't have the resources for that, it would also make the model bloody expensive!). If I recal correctly they tried 'overflowing' the mould to try and get enough metal in there but this wears the moulds out too quickly and is not at all cost affective! (the Models would have to be sold at about ?100 each, or more!)
But the prow is fine! However it is extremely unlikley that this will be released any time in this decade! Since the Battle fleet mars ships 'should' be comming out in a year or so! (Snip) Have fun,
